Active Report 6页脚没有增长

时间:2013-07-11 13:04:19

标签: activereports

我们使用Active Report 6版本进行报告。我们有一个案例,我们需要在页脚中显示少量行。这些行是动态的,即有时它会是3或6或任何数字。

我已经搜索了很多并在一个URL(http://www.datadynamics.com/forums/35718/PrintPost.aspx)上提到了Page Header&页面页脚不允许在Active Report中增长。

我还试图在“PageFooter”的“Before_Print”事件中重新调整页脚高度。不过,没有运气!

是否有任何我可以动态调整页脚大小的规定?

2 个答案:

答案 0 :(得分:1)

使用ReportStart事件运行单独的查询以确定所需的行数,并相应地调整PageHeader / Footer的大小。

答案 1 :(得分:0)

页面创建后,PageFooter和PageHeader在页面上是固定大小的,因为它们的大小决定了内容的剩余区域。在每页的基础上修改它的唯一方法是在PageStart事件中。因此,在每个页面的开头,您可以检查需要在该页面上打印的记录数,并更改页面页脚部分的大小。没有其他选择。